Africans, mostly Nigerians, are producing fake money orders and sending several thousand dollars "extra." They want you to cash the check and forward the balance to their "shipping agents". 7 days later your bank returns the check to you as bogus and you're out the $$ you forwarded to the agent. Sounds pretty close to the email I got when I was selling our waverunner...the guy was in Africa or somewhere but had a friend in England that owed him money. The guy in England was gonna send me a check for the amount of the waverunner and the balance he owed his buddy in Africa (like 5-grand!)...I was to send the extra $5k to the guy in Africa. Yeah, right...
